Modern Nordic Ceramic Vase Sourcing Guide

Sourcing modern Nordic ceramic vases requires a nuanced understanding of minimalist design principles and material integrity. These pieces are defined by clean lines, muted earth tones, and functional elegance, making them staples in contemporary home decor. Buyers must distinguish between mass-produced items and artisanal pieces, as the latter often command higher prices due to hand-finished details and unique glaze variations. The aesthetic relies heavily on the interplay between matte and glossy finishes, which can significantly alter the visual weight and texture of the final product.

Procurement teams should prioritize suppliers who demonstrate expertise in both porcelain and stoneware, as these materials offer the durability and refined finish expected in Nordic design. It is crucial to verify that the supplier’s production capabilities align with the specific stylistic requirements, such as the ability to produce subtle color variations or precise geometric forms. Understanding the supply chain’s capacity for customization is equally important, as many buyers seek tailored dimensions or specific glaze colors to match existing interior design schemes.

Technical Specifications to Verify

Verifying technical specifications is critical to ensuring that the ceramic vases meet both aesthetic and functional standards. Buyers should confirm the exact dimensions, including diameter and height, as these directly impact the vase’s suitability for specific floral arrangements or display spaces. The finish type, whether matte or gloss, must be explicitly defined in the product specifications, as this affects the visual appeal and tactile experience. Additionally, the glaze type, such as on-glazed or color-glazed, should be verified to ensure consistency across batches and resistance to chipping or fading.

Material composition is another vital specification, with porcelain and ceramic being the primary materials used. Buyers must ensure that the material density and firing temperature meet industry standards for durability. The production process, whether hand-made or machine-blown, influences the final product’s uniqueness and cost. Hand-made items often feature slight variations that add character, while machine-produced items offer uniformity. Clarifying these details with suppliers prevents misunderstandings and ensures that the final products align with the buyer’s quality expectations.

Compliance and Safety Documentation

Compliance and safety documentation are essential for importing ceramic vases, particularly when they are intended for use in homes or commercial spaces. Buyers must ensure that suppliers provide certificates of compliance with relevant food safety standards, even if the vases are primarily decorative, as they may come into contact with water or other substances. Lead-free certification is crucial to prevent contamination, especially if the vases are used for holding flowers with water that might be accessed by children or pets.

Additionally, buyers should request test reports for heavy metal leaching, ensuring that the glazes and pigments used do not contain harmful substances. These tests should be conducted by accredited laboratories to guarantee accuracy and reliability. Documentation regarding the origin of materials and the manufacturing process can also provide insights into the product’s ethical sourcing and environmental impact. Maintaining a complete file of these documents is vital for regulatory compliance and for addressing any potential liability issues in the destination market.

Cost Drivers and Commercial Terms

Understanding the cost drivers behind modern Nordic ceramic vases helps buyers negotiate better terms and manage their budgets effectively. The primary cost factors include material quality, production complexity, and customization requirements. Hand-made items and those with intricate glaze patterns typically incur higher costs due to the labor-intensive processes involved. Buyers should also consider the impact of packaging, as safe carton or pallet packaging adds to the overall cost but is essential for preventing damage during transit.

Commercial terms such as minimum order quantities, payment terms, and lead times significantly influence the total cost of ownership. Suppliers may offer discounts for larger orders, but buyers must balance this with their inventory management capabilities. It is important to clarify whether the quoted prices include shipping and insurance, as these can add substantial costs. Negotiating flexible payment terms, such as partial upfront payments, can help manage cash flow. Understanding these commercial dynamics allows buyers to make informed decisions that align with their financial strategies.
